Abstract

The utility model discloses a high-voltage switch breaker convenient for replacing a disconnecting link, which comprises a breaker shell, wherein three breaker bodies are arranged on the top surface of the breaker shell, current transformers are respectively arranged on the three breaker bodies, connecting blocks are respectively and symmetrically fixedly connected on the current transformers, connecting holes are respectively arranged on the connecting blocks, one ends of movable contact blades are respectively hinged between the connecting blocks through hinging bolts, one ends of the movable contact blades are provided with mounting holes, the hinging bolts are respectively clamped in the connecting holes and the mounting holes, two sides of the movable contact blades positioned in the middle are respectively fixedly connected with one end of a fixing rod, and the other ends of the fixing rods are respectively fixedly connected with one sides of the other two movable contact blades. According to the utility model, the position of the movable contact knife can be fixed through the movable component when the circuit is connected, so that the movable contact knife is prevented from moving in the use process, and the movable contact knife can be prevented from contacting the fixed contact by the movable component when the circuit is disconnected, so that the safety of equipment is improved.

Background
A circuit breaker refers to a switching device capable of closing, carrying and opening a current under normal circuit conditions and closing, carrying and opening a current under abnormal circuit conditions within a prescribed time. The circuit breaker can be used for distributing electric energy, starting the asynchronous motor infrequently, protecting a power line, the motor and the like, and automatically cutting off the circuit when serious overload or short circuit, undervoltage and other faults occur, and the functions of the circuit breaker are equivalent to the combination of a fuse type switch, an over-under-heating relay and the like. A wide range of applications have been achieved. When three-phase alternating current high-voltage power is connected to a user, a breaker with a disconnecting switch in high-voltage vacuum must be assembled.
To this end, the chinese patent of the utility model with the publication number CN214672377U discloses a vacuum circuit breaker with an isolation knife switch, which comprises a base, the left top of the base is fixedly provided with a circuit breaker vacuum box main body, the bottom of the left outer wall of the circuit breaker vacuum box main body is fixedly connected with a lower wiring board, the bottom inner wall of the circuit breaker vacuum box main body is fixedly provided with a built-in voltage transformer, the top of the circuit breaker vacuum box main body is fixedly provided with a plastic spraying box body, and the top of the plastic spraying box body is fixedly provided with a voltage transformer. This take vacuum circuit breaker who keeps apart switch is convenient for keep apart the fixed of switch through the first switch spliced pole that sets up, the installation of first switch spliced pole of being convenient for through the first fixed column of the first fixed plate cooperation that sets up, the installation that is favorable to the second switch spliced pole is fixed through the second erection column cooperation second mounting hole that sets up for it is more convenient to dismantle in the installation of keeping apart the switch, improves work efficiency greatly.
However, the disconnecting link of the device lacks a limiting structure, and can possibly generate displacement in the use process, so that the safety performance is lower, and the high-voltage switch breaker convenient for replacing the disconnecting link is provided for solving the problems.

Example 3
Referring to fig. 1 to 4, a third embodiment of the present utility model is based on the above two embodiments;
When the movable contact knife 3 is used, the movable contact knife 3 is limited and fixed through the limiting groove 92 on the limiting block 91 in the moving assembly 9, so that the movable contact knife 3 is prevented from moving, when a circuit is required to be disconnected, the moving rod 95 can drive one limiting block 91 to move through the rotating block 98, the rest limiting block 91 is simultaneously driven to move through the connecting rod 93, the movable contact knife 3 is separated from the limiting groove 92, then the movable contact knife 3 is lifted up through the insulating handle 302, the circuit can be disconnected, the limiting block 91 can be returned to the original position through the rotating block 98, the fixed contact 801 is prevented from being contacted with the movable contact knife 3, the safety of equipment is improved, when the parts of the knife switch are required to be replaced, the movable contact knife 3 can be detached integrally through the insulating handle 302 after the hinged bolt 4 is detached, the other parts of the knife switch are convenient to overhaul, the damaged knife switch parts can be replaced in time, and the equipment is convenient to replace the damaged knife switch parts rapidly, and the efficiency is high.
